Access Gateway Authentications Test
In the Citrix StoreFront server, Callback URLs are configured to verify if requests received from the NetScaler Gateway appliance actually originate from that appliance only. If StoreFront takes too long to verify and authenticate the source of the NetScaler requests, users will experience a significant delay when attempting to access published apps via StoreFront. This is why, administrators should track Callback calls made by StoreFront and proactively detect any current or potential latency in the processing of these calls. The Access Gateway Authentications test can help administrators with this.
This test reports the rate at which Callback calls are processed by StoreFront. In addition, the time taken for verifying the authenticity of the NetScaler requests via Callback calls is also measured. This way, the test sheds light on possible bottlenecks in the processing of Callback calls.
